15.5.7 Transmit Multichannel Selection Modes
The XMCM bits of XCR2 determine whether all channels or only selected channels are enabled and unmasked
for transmission. More details on enabling and masking are in
. The McBSP has three transmit
multichannel selection modes (XMCM = 01b, XMCM = 10b, and XMCM = 11b), which are described in the
following table.
Table 15-13. Selecting a Transmit Multichannel Selection Mode With the XMCM Bits
XMCM
Transmit Multichannel Selection Mode
00b
No transmit multichannel selection mode is on. All channels are enabled and unmasked. No channels can be
disabled or masked.
01b
All channels are disabled unless they are selected in the appropriate transmit channel enable registers
(XCERs). If enabled, a channel in this mode is also unmasked.
The XMCME bit of MCR2 determines whether 32 channels or 128 channels are selectable in XCERs.
10b
All channels are enabled, but they are masked unless they are selected in the appropriate transmit channel
enable registers (XCERs).
The XMCME bit of MCR2 determines whether 32 channels or 128 channels are selectable in XCERs.
11b
This mode is used for symmetric transmission and reception.
All channels are disabled for transmission unless they are enabled for reception in the appropriate receive
channel enable registers (RCERs). Once enabled, they are masked unless they are also selected in the
appropriate transmit channel enable registers (XCERs).
The XMCME bit of MCR2 determines whether 32 channels or 128 channels are selectable in RCERs and
XCERs.
As an example of how the McBSP behaves in a transmit multichannel selection mode, suppose that XMCM =
01b (all channels disabled unless individually enabled) and that you have enabled only channels 0, 15, and 39.
Suppose also that the frame length is 40. The McBSP:…
1. Shifts data to the DX pin in channel 0
2. Places the DX pin in the high impedance state in channels 1-14
3. Shifts data to the DX pin in channel 15
4. Places the DX pin in the high impedance state in channels 16-38
5. Shifts data to the DX pin in channel 39
